Stop Dumping Docs Into Context: The Core of Agent Engineering is Lean Memory

gethackteam · x · 2026-08-11

The author points out that developers building AI agents often obsess over larger context windows while neglecting input optimization. Just because a model supports 1 million tokens doesn't mean filling it is a good idea. The context window should be treated as efficient working memory, not a documentation dump. The core challenge is learning how to use context more sparingly and effectively.
